top of page
Developer Blog


Lambdae Forever
A quick tech musing about naming, correctness, and personal preference - featuring the very incorrect but deeply satisfying term “lambdae.”

Jeff Ranasinghe
Apr 281 min read


🌀 Loop Life: Inspired by Interruptions
A quick post about making loops in unexpected places — and why TikTok's been the perfect space to share them.

Jeff Ranasinghe
Apr 241 min read


Percentages Are Stupid
A short tech rant about why percentages are stupid, perune should be normalized, and language is a little bit fake anyway.

Jeff Ranasinghe
Apr 211 min read


How to Loop a Video on iPhone — Without Editing
A practical guide to looping a video on iPhone — no editing, no timelines. Just live performance and creative flow.

Jeff Ranasinghe
Apr 192 min read


Looping in Unexpected Places
A quick post about making loops in unexpected places — and why TikTok's been the perfect space to share them.

Jeff Ranasinghe
Apr 131 min read


Your First Loop with Muser Studio
How to make your first loop in Muser Studio - from recording to layering to sharing your final video.

Jeff Ranasinghe
Apr 83 min read


The Mystery Hang: Debugging a Swift-C++ Interop Bug After Launch
After launching Muser Studio, I uncovered a Swift-C++ interop bug causing hangs in certain App Store regions. Here's how I fixed it.

Jeff Ranasinghe
Apr 62 min read


🌀Video Looping for iPhone - What If Video Loops Were Instruments?
Meet Muser Studio — an iOS app that lets you record video and define looping sections while you're recording. Think live audio looping, but

Jeff Ranasinghe
Apr 32 min read
bottom of page